David Larsen KK4WW became interested in electronics as a boy and
was licensed as an Amateur Radio Operator in 1953. After graduating from
high school in 1957, he served in Uncle Sam’s Navy for 2 years as an
electronic technician, and went to Oregon State University for a degree in
Business and Technology (Electronics). He spent some years in the
electronic industry as an engineer, and the next 31 as a university
teacher in electronic instrumentation at Virginia Tech in Blacksburg, VA
(retired 1998). For ten years at VT, David assisted the Office of
International Development and received the Faculty Service Award in 1995
for “outstanding service in the outreach mission”. For many of those
years, he was associated with land and farming with the start-up of a
Christmas tree farm and marketing organization, which developed into a
serious operation with hundreds of acres of Christmas trees and was a good
sale for Larsen in 1993.
In 1992, David and his wife Gaynell KK4WW founded the non-profit
foundation,
Foundation for Amateur International Radio Service (FAIRS) to work
with groups in less fortunate countries to develop emergency radio
communications systems and provide medical and equipment assistance. David
and Gaynell direct the activities of the foundation from U.S. headquarters
in Floyd, VA.
